About BGCH
The mission of Boys & Girls Clubs of Hawaii is to enable all young people, especially those who need us most, to reach their full potential as productive, caring, responsible citizens.
The after-school hours have become a critical time for youth – a time when many children in our communities are left to fend for themselves without positive adult supervision.
We provide a safe place filled with hope and opportunity, ongoing relationships with caring adult mentors, and enriching programs.Overview of the role:
The Development Coordinator is a critical administrative and operational support role within the Development team.
This position provides operational and administrative support to the Development team, helping ensure fundraising events, initiatives, donor tracking, and development systems are well-coordinated, organized, and executed efficiently.
The ideal candidate is highly organized, detail-oriented, a strong communicator, and passionate about supporting the mission of the Boys & Girls Club of Hawaii.

Fundraising & Event Initiatives Support
Assists with the logistics for all major fundraising events and organization-wide fundraising initiatives.
Executes and maintains event timelines, task lists, and deadlines, including coordinating and completing assigned tasks within project management tools.
Supports Club-based fundraising efforts with coordination tools and tracking mechanisms.
Committee & Meeting Coordination
Schedules meetings for development-related committees and working groups.
Prepares agendas, meeting materials, meeting minutes, and notes for distribution.
Tracks action items and follows up with team members to support on-time completion of tasks.
Donor & Gift Tracking
Assists the Donor Systems Coordinator with tracking donations, donor engagement, and giving history within the organization's Constituent Relationship Management (CRM) system.
Assists with running standard and ad-hoc donor reports in the CRM.Stewardship Support
Assists with donor acknowledgments and follow-up communications in a timely and professional manner.
Tracks stewardship touchpoints to ensure consistent donor recognition and care.
Supports Development leads by ensuring BGCH assets (e.g., presentations, impact reports, one-pagers) are updated and produced for meetings, handouts, and marketing purposes.
Administrative & Operational SupportMaintains organized development files, calendars, and documentation (digital and physical).
Assists with general data entry, report preparation, and internal tracking tools.
Supports internal process improvements related to overall development operations.
